Transaction 3b25439a6275fa8c021a185353f133dd59eac2137499b6127ba135bd08efe952
1 Input
1 Output
-
3b25439a6275fa8c021a185353f133dd59eac2137499b6127ba135bd08efe952:0
- value
- 1299212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33b28256111591549f6a1a37648c233b3b9e8bbc OP_EQUAL
- address
- 36QNEMkbYyMDWgSG7C121q9BZ8KtR6CEZU